Russian fighter jet Su-30 crashes during training, 2 pilots killed
16-Nov-2025.
A Russian Su-30 fighter jet crashed on November 13 during a routine training flight in the Karelia region, which borders Finland, killing both pilots on board, the Russian Defence Ministry confirmed.
The crash is the latest in a growing number of non-combat aviation accidents involving Russian military aircraft in recent months.
According to a statement released by the Defence Ministry, the incident occurred at around 7 pm (Moscow time). The ministry said the aircraft went down in an uninhabited area and was not carrying any ammunition at the time.
